Understanding the YSL Baby Doll Mascara Promise:
The YSL Baby Doll Mascara, specifically the "Volume Effet Faux Cils Waterproof" version in Charcoal Black (#1), promises a dramatic, doll-like lash effect without the clumping or flaking associated with some volumizing mascaras. The brand emphasizes the creation of a "baby doll" eye look – wide-eyed and innocent yet undeniably captivating. This is achieved through a unique brush design and a carefully formulated texture. The 6.9ml/0.23oz tube provides a decent amount of product for regular use. Unpacking the Features and Benefits:
The YSL Baby Doll Mascara distinguishes itself through several key features:
* The Iconic Brush: The unique brush design plays a critical role in achieving the desired effect. Its slightly curved shape and densely packed bristles are designed to coat each lash individually, from root to tip, separating and lengthening without clumping. This precision application is crucial for creating the open, wide-eyed look that defines the "baby doll" aesthetic. The brush's flexibility allows for easy maneuvering around the delicate lash line, reaching even the smallest lashes in the inner and outer corners of the eye.
* The Formula: The waterproof formula is a significant selling point for many consumers. It offers exceptional staying power, resisting smudging and running even under humid conditions or with prolonged wear. This is particularly beneficial for those who lead active lifestyles or live in climates with high humidity. The formula itself is lightweight yet buildable, allowing for customizable volume and length. Multiple coats can be applied without creating excessive clumping, a common issue with many volumizing mascaras.
* The Finish: The mascara delivers a rich, intensely black finish, further enhancing the dramatic effect. The black pigment is deeply saturated, providing a bold and defined look that complements a wide range of eye colors and makeup styles. The finish is not overly glossy or wet, instead offering a slightly more matte appearance that helps prevent any potential clumping or spider-leg effect.
* Long-lasting Wear: The waterproof formulation ensures the mascara remains in place throughout the day, resisting smudging, flaking, and running. This is a significant advantage for long days at work or special occasions where touch-ups aren't practical. Many users report the mascara lasting well into the evening without requiring reapplication.
